Creator:
Foster, Tom
Inclusive Dates:
Abstract:
The Tom Foster Papers contain materials
from his work on the book Their Darkest Day: The Tragedy of Pan Am
103 and Its Legacy of Hope, co-authored with Matthew Cox. These materials
include mostly Research Files pertaining to Subjects and
People and accompanied by the author's handwritten notes. Other series include Chapter Notes, Clippings and
Newspapers, and Photographs and
Negatives

Creator:
Read, Thomas (fl. 1624)
Inclusive Dates:
1624- 1624
Abstract:
Compiled ca. 1624 by Thomas Read, a student at Oxford
University's Magdalen College. Entitled "a not-booke of divinity and honor military and civill." The author may have been
that Thomas Read (1606-1669) who was Latin secretary to the crown for King Charles II.

Creator:
Bailey, Theodorus, 1805-1877.
Inclusive Dates:
1828- 1877
Abstract:
Papers of the Admiral, United States Navy. Collection includes correspondence (1828-1874), much of which relates to Bailey's Civil War service; naval orders, circulars, reports and directives, and personal memorabilia.
